01 - Request
**A roundtripRequest can not be used with other requests. A reservation MUST have only a roundtrip
02 - HotelReservationRequest
ReservationRequest Without Payment (prebooking)
<ReservationRequest x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<BaseRequest xmlns="http://webservicesV2.bookcyprus.com/">
<UserName>****</UserName>
<Password>*****</Password>
<Currency>EUR</Currency>
<Language>EN</Language>
</BaseRequest>
<Title xmlns="http://webservicesV2.bookcyprus.com/">Mr.</Title>
<FirstName xmlns="http://webservicesV2.bookcyprus.com/">Andreas</FirstName>
<LastName xmlns="http://webservicesV2.bookcyprus.com/">Michaelou</LastName>
<Address xmlns="http://webservicesV2.bookcyprus.com/">Makariou Av</Address>
<Email xmlns="http://webservicesV2.bookcyprus.com/">dev@spidernet.net</Email>
<City xmlns="http://webservicesV2.bookcyprus.com/">Nicosia</City>
<CountryId xmlns="http://webservicesV2.bookcyprus.com/">0</CountryId>
<MobileNumber xmlns="http://webservicesV2.bookcyprus.com/">99000000</MobileNumber>
<Remarks xmlns="http://webservicesV2.bookcyprus.com/">Test reservation</Remarks>
<ApplyPrepayment xmlns="http://webservicesV2.bookcyprus.com/">true</ApplyPrepayment>
<HotelRequests xmlns="http://webservicesV2.bookcyprus.com/">
<HotelReservationRequest>
<HotelId>147</HotelId>
<RoomId>717</RoomId>
<MealId>6</MealId>
<ProviderId>0</ProviderId>
<GroupIdentifier>0</GroupIdentifier>
<ExpectedBookingPrice>1155.00</ExpectedBookingPrice>
<GuestName>John Doe</GuestName>
<Occupancy>
<RoomIndex>1</RoomIndex>
<Adults>2</Adults>
</Occupancy>
<FromDate>2014-10-01T00:00:00</FromDate>
<ToDate>2014-10-22T00:00:00</ToDate>
</HotelReservationRequest>
</HotelRequests>
</ReservationRequest>
03 - ExcursionReservationRequest
Sample
<ReservationRequest x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<BaseRequest xmlns="http://webservicesV2.bookcyprus.com/">
<UserName>****</UserName>
<Password>*****</Password>
<Currency>EUR</Currency>
<Language>EN</Language>
</BaseRequest>
<Title xmlns="http://webservicesV2.bookcyprus.com/">Mr.</Title>
<FirstName xmlns="http://webservicesV2.bookcyprus.com/">Andreas</FirstName>
<LastName xmlns="http://webservicesV2.bookcyprus.com/">Michaelou</LastName>
<Address xmlns="http://webservicesV2.bookcyprus.com/">Makariou Av</Address>
<Email xmlns="http://webservicesV2.bookcyprus.com/">dev@spidernet.net</Email>
<City xmlns="http://webservicesV2.bookcyprus.com/">Nicosia</City>
<CountryId xmlns="http://webservicesV2.bookcyprus.com/">0</CountryId>
<MobileNumber xmlns="http://webservicesV2.bookcyprus.com/">99000000</MobileNumber>
<Remarks xmlns="http://webservicesV2.bookcyprus.com/">Test reservation</Remarks>
<ApplyPrepayment xmlns="http://webservicesV2.bookcyprus.com/">true</ApplyPrepayment>
<ExcursionRequests xmlns="http://webservicesV2.bookcyprus.com/">
<ExcursionReservationRequest>
<PickupLocationId>1311</PickupLocationId>
<ExcursionServiceId>1565</ExcursionServiceId>
<Adults>1</Adults>
<Children>0</Children>
<Infants>0</Infants>
<Seniors>0</Seniors>
<NumberOfVehicles>0</NumberOfVehicles>
<PickupTime>2015-06-19T14:00:00</PickupTime>
<TravelDate>2015-06-25T00:00:00</TravelDate>
</ExcursionReservationRequest>
</ExcursionRequests>
</ReservationRequest>
04 - TransferReservationRequest
Sample
<ReservationRequest x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<BaseRequest xmlns="http://webservicesV2.bookcyprus.com/">
<UserName>********</UserName>
<Password>*****</Password>
<Currency>USD</Currency>
<Language>EN</Language>
</BaseRequest>
<Title xmlns="http://webservicesV2.bookcyprus.com/">Mr.</Title>
<FirstName xmlns="http://webservicesV2.bookcyprus.com/">Andreas</FirstName>
<LastName xmlns="http://webservicesV2.bookcyprus.com/">Michaelou</LastName>
<Address xmlns="http://webservicesV2.bookcyprus.com/">Makariou Av.</Address>
<Email xmlns="http://webservicesV2.bookcyprus.com/">dev@spidernet.net</Email>
<City xmlns="http://webservicesV2.bookcyprus.com/">Nicosia</City>
<CountryId xmlns="http://webservicesV2.bookcyprus.com/">0</CountryId>
<MobileNumber xmlns="http://webservicesV2.bookcyprus.com/">99000000</MobileNumber>
<Remarks xmlns="http://webservicesV2.bookcyprus.com/">Test reservation</Remarks>
<ApplyPrepayment xmlns="http://webservicesV2.bookcyprus.com/">true</ApplyPrepayment>
<TransferRequests xmlns="http://webservicesV2.bookcyprus.com/">
<TransferReservationRequest>
<VehicleId>31</VehicleId>
<TransferServiceId>121692</TransferServiceId>
<FromLocationId>1364</FromLocationId>
<ToLocationId>11628</ToLocationId>
<FromHotelId>0</FromHotelId>
<ToHotelId>0</ToHotelId>
<FromDate>2015-07-02T00:00:00</FromDate>
<ToDate>2015-07-04T00:00:00</ToDate>
<NumberOfVehicles>1</NumberOfVehicles>
<IsOneWay>false</IsOneWay>
<Passengers>2</Passengers>
<TransferData>
<ArrivalTime>01:00</ArrivalTime>
<ArrivalHotel>Hotel here A</ArrivalHotel>
<DepartureFlightNumber>AE001</DepartureFlightNumber>
<DepartureAirline>AE</DepartureAirline>
<DepartureTime>02:00</DepartureTime>
<ReturnArrivalFlightNumber>AE002</ReturnArrivalFlightNumber>
<ReturnArrivalAirline>AE</ReturnArrivalAirline>
<ReturnArrivalTime>03:00</ReturnArrivalTime>
<ReturnDepartureTime>04:00</ReturnDepartureTime>
<ReturnDepartureHotel>Hotel here A</ReturnDepartureHotel>
<IsOneWay>false</IsOneWay>
<IsOneWayArrival>false</IsOneWayArrival>
</TransferData>
</TransferReservationRequest>
</TransferRequests>
</ReservationRequest>
05 - RoundtripReservationRequest
06 - Itinerary
XML Field
ItineraryId
ItineraryServices
Description
The unique itinerary identification
Array of ItineraryService
07 - ItineraryService
XML Field
ItineraryServiceId
Description
The unique service itinerary identification
Sample
<?xml version="1.0" encoding="utf-16"?>
<ReservationRequest x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<BaseRequest xmlns="http://webservicesV2.bookcyprus.com/">
<UserName>*****</UserName>
<Password>*****</Password>
<Currency>USD</Currency>
<Language>EN</Language>
</BaseRequest>
<Title xmlns="http://webservicesV2.bookcyprus.com/">Mr.</Title>
<FirstName xmlns="http://webservicesV2.bookcyprus.com/">Argyris</FirstName>
<LastName xmlns="http://webservicesV2.bookcyprus.com/">Argyrou</LastName>
<Address xmlns="http://webservicesV2.bookcyprus.com/">Zenas Kanther 12</Address>
<Email xmlns="http://webservicesV2.bookcyprus.com/">dev@belugga.com</Email>
<City xmlns="http://webservicesV2.bookcyprus.com/">Nicosia</City>
<CountryId xmlns="http://webservicesV2.bookcyprus.com/">0</CountryId>
<MobileNumber xmlns="http://webservicesV2.bookcyprus.com/">99000000</MobileNumber>
<Remarks xmlns="http://webservicesV2.bookcyprus.com/">Test reservation</Remarks>
<ApplyPrepayment xmlns="http://webservicesV2.bookcyprus.com/">true</ApplyPrepayment>
<AgencyReference xmlns="http://webservicesV2.bookcyprus.com/">AGENCY 1 2 3</AgencyReference>
<PaymentRequest xmlns="http://webservicesV2.bookcyprus.com/">
<BaseRequest>
<UserName>sitaonlineservices@testcredentials.com</UserName>
<Password>sitaonlineservices123</Password>
<Currency>USD</Currency>
<Language>DE</Language>
</BaseRequest>
<PaymentMethod>ONACCOUNT</PaymentMethod>
<ReservationId>0</ReservationId>
</PaymentRequest>
<RoundtripRequest xmlns="http://webservicesV2.bookcyprus.com/">
<RoundtripId>52</RoundtripId>
<StartDate>2016-08-09T00:00:00</StartDate>
<RoomOccupancies>
<HotelOccupancy>
<RoomIndex>1</RoomIndex>
<Adults>2</Adults>
</HotelOccupancy>
<HotelOccupancy>
<RoomIndex>2</RoomIndex>
<Adults>2</Adults>
<ChildrenAges>
<int>5</int>
</ChildrenAges>
</HotelOccupancy>
</RoomOccupancies>
</RoundtripRequest>
</ReservationRequest>